How much does an Aipi Solutions Legal Intern make?

As of April 2025, the average annual salary for a Legal Intern at Aipi Solutions is $70,073, which translates to approximately $34 per hour. Salaries for Legal Intern at Aipi Solutions typically range from $63,460 to $76,651,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

It's essential to understand that sal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as geographic location, departmental budget, and individual qualifications. Key determinants include years of experience, specific skill sets, educational background, and relevant certifications. AiPi LLC is a leading innovation management company that helps companies grow and maximize their value by developing, scaling and monetizing their intellectual property assets. We deliver our services in five key areas, including strategic patent services, litigation finance, commercialization, U.S. market entry and traditional IP services.

  3. Legal Research: Legal research is "the process of identifying and retrieving information necessary to support legal decision-making. In its broadest sense, legal research includes each step of a course of action that begins with an analysis of the facts of a problem and concludes with the application and communication of the results of the investigation." The processes of legal research vary according to the country and the legal system involved. However, legal research generally involves tasks such as: Finding primary sources of law, or primary authority, in a given jurisdiction (cases, statutes, regulations, etc.). Searching secondary authority (for example, law reviews, legal dictionaries, legal treatises, and legal encyclopedias such as American Jurisprudence and Corpus Juris Secundum), for background information about a legal topic. Searching non-legal sources for investigative or supporting information.
